March 26th - 29th 2018, the UNESCO Documentation & Advisory Services (UDAS) Workshop 4 was organised in Beirut & Baalbek. The event took place in the framework of the Baalbek & Tyre Archaeological Project (BTAP), part of the Cultural Heritage & Urban Development (CHUD).

This edition was specifically organised to discuss the conservation works on the colonnade of the temple of Jupiter in Baalbek planned in the framework of BTAP II. In the present report, comments and recommendations are made on the on-going and future works of stone conservation and on the proposed structural interventions. They are based on the analysis of the documents sent
by CDR through UNESCO – for the present and previous workshops –, on observations made during the two days of visit of the site and on discussions engaged during the workshop in Beirut and Baalbek. Comments are also made on the structural and surface conservation measures completed in the framework of BTAP I and on the presentation measured planned in the framework of BTAP II.
